Herald Coaster, April 27, 1978:

Funeral services for Ernest Meyer, 80, of Damon, were held at 2 p.m. Thursday at the First English Lutheran Church in Damon. The Rev. Harold E. Fehler officiated and burial was in Greenlawn Memorial Park.

Mr. Meyer died Tuesday at his residence. A native of San Felipe, he was a farmer. He was also a member of the First English Lutheran Church in Damon.

He is survived by two sons, Clarence Meyer of Sugar Land and Leslie Meyer of Needville; seven grandchildren; two great-grandchildren; one brother, Eddie Meyer of Damon; and two sisters, Mrs. Ella Kraft Braeuer and Mrs. Hermina Stuhrenberg Lehmann, both of Needville.

Memorials may be made to the First English Lutheran Church in Damon.

Funeral arrangements were under the direction of Garmany and Company Funeral Directors in Needville.
